With one of the largest displays in the entire smartphone marketplace, the LG Spectrum 4G Android handset is the first such device to deliver true In Plane Switching (IPS) display technology to a Verizon Wireless 4G LTE smartphone. IPS technology allows for detailed, high-resolution viewing even at extreme angles, delivers a sharp, high clarity picture, and helps reduce glare in bright light situations and direct sunlight. The handset delivers an extremely high pixel density and display resolution when compared to other 4G handsets, the above-mentioned large display, a substantial RAM memory allotment and one of the fastest processors in the entire smartphone arena. The LG Spectrum arrived on January 19 on that Verizon Wireless 4G LTE system which independent wireless reviewer RootMetrics claims outperformed the other big three US wireless carriers in upload, download speeds and consistency of performance in their tests. The multitouch, capacitive, True HD IPS touch screen display runs 4.50 inches, and delivers 326 pixels per inch to the LCD display for an overall screen resolution of 720 x 1280 pixels. More than 16 million colors are used when rendering visual display, and that screen is protected by an overlay of scratch resistant Gorilla Glass. Above 4G-average talk time of 8.30 hours is delivered from a single charge of the 1,830 mA battery, and 14.5 days of standby is also offered.

The LG Spectrum 4G Android smartphone runs the Gingerbread operating system out-of-the-box, and the Qualcomm MSM8660 Snapdragon chip set includes a speedy, dual core 1.5 GHz Scorpion CPU and graphics dedicated Adreno 220 chip. 4 GB of built-in storage and 1.0 GB of RAM system memory join the hardware package, and a microSD slot is present for storage expansion and off board data access.

In the camera combo on board the LG Spectrum, a rear mounted 8.0 megapixel camcorder comes equipped with an LED flash and F2.4 aperture, while delivering a substantial list of customization features. Autofocus, exposure control, face detection, ISO control, geo-tagging, white balance, preloaded scenes, special effects and a self timer all deliver one of the most extensive camera feature packages on any 4G smartphone.

That camcorder has the capability of capturing video at 1920 x 1080 (1080P) HD resolution, and the front facing 1.3 megapixel chat cam also allows for video call options. The on board dedicated mic with active noise cancellation supports video dialing, video memos and other voice commands.
